Roger Federer announces retirement from tennis after stellar career

  • Swiss great to call time on career at end of month
  • In pictures: Federer’s remarkable tennis career

Roger Federer will retire next week at the age of 41 after the Laver Cup in London, marking the end of one of the greatest ever sporting careers.

A 20-time grand slam champion, Federer announced in a social media post on Thursday that next week will be his last as a professional player. Federer’s management firm, Team8, are founders of the Laver Cup, a Ryder Cup-style event.
